* fix(storage): address internode data-path review findings

- Run the BatchReadVersion auto-mode unary fallback outside the batch
  RPC deadline so each read_version keeps its own per-op timeout and
  health accounting instead of racing the whole batch against one
  drive timeout.
- Cap adaptive batch-processor concurrency growth at a hard multiple
  of the configured baseline so sustained fast batches cannot ratchet
  past the configured limit.
- Parse RUSTFS_INTERNODE_HTTP_* tuning, RUSTFS_BATCH_PROCESSOR_ADAPTIVE,
  and RUSTFS_METADATA_BATCH_READ once per process instead of re-reading
  the environment on hot paths.
- Skip shard read-cost collection in observe mode when stage metrics
  are disabled, and cache the local endpoint host list instead of
  rebuilding it on every read.
- Allow --warp-extra-args values starting with -- and drop the unused
  warp_hosts_csv helper in the issue-797 A/B runner.
